Block

#21,746,769
Block Number
21,746,769 @ 05/23/2025, 10:41:40
Status
Finalized
ID
0x014bd4518014c58f6d4dab22fa5fe99a0d9f0e3b98e927b4e106d73d552acfa1
Transactions
Gas Used
4124768/40000000 (10.31% Used)
Total Score
2,123,845,130 (+98)
Rewards
14.73 VTHO